How to Use Paint to Refresh Your Furniture

refresh furniture with paint

Finding that perfect piece at a thrift store is just the beginning of the fun! Now, let’s bring that furniture to life with a splash of paint. It’s easier than you think, and you’ll feel like a pro in no time! Here’s how to get started:

  1. Choose Your Color: Pick a shade that speaks to you. Bright colors can energize, while soft tones offer calm.
  2. Prep Your Piece: Clean it well, sand any rough spots, and don’t forget to use a primer for a smooth finish.
  3. Apply the Paint: Use a brush or spray paint for even coverage. Don’t rush—let each coat dry completely before adding more.

With these steps, your thrift store find will shine brighter than ever!

Thrift Store Planters: Breathing Life Into Old Containers

thrift store planter transformation

Transforming old containers into charming planters can be a delightful adventure! You’ll find unique pieces at thrift stores, like teacups, wooden crates, or even old boots. Just imagine how fun it is to plant colorful flowers in a quirky teapot! Start by cleaning your container and adding drainage holes if needed. Then, fill it with potting soil and your favorite plants. You can even paint or decorate the containers to match your style. It’s amazing how a little creativity can breathe new life into something forgotten. Plus, you’ll feel proud every time you see those lovely plants thriving. Frequently Asked Questions

What Are the Best Tools for DIY Thrift Store Transformations?

You’ll need a good paintbrush, spray paint, sandpaper, and a hot glue gun for DIY thrift store transformations. Don’t forget a measuring tape and a quality sealer to finish your projects beautifully!

How Do I Choose a Color Palette for Thrifted Items?

Choosing a color palette for thrifted items is like picking paint for a canvas. Start by considering three to five complementary hues, then gather inspiration from nature, fabrics, or artwork to create a cohesive look.

Can Thrift Store Decor Fit Into Any Design Style?

Yes, thrift store decor can fit into any design style. You can mix vintage pieces with modern accents, creating a unique aesthetic. Just choose items that resonate with your vision, and you’ll achieve a cohesive look.

How Do I Clean and Prepare Thrift Finds for Projects?

First, grab your trusty spray bottle! Clean your thrift finds with soap and water, then dry them thoroughly. For wood, use a gentle cleaner. Sand any rough edges, and you’re ready to transform!

What Should I Avoid When Selecting Thrift Store Decor?

Avoid items with heavy damage, unpleasant odors, or missing parts. Don’t overlook functionality—make sure it works. Steer clear of trends that might fade quickly; you want timeless pieces that enhance your space for years.
